的实现Oracle序列的实现:一步一步探索(oracle当前序列)

Oracle序列是Oracle数据库提供的一种技术,用于生成唯一的数字,从而满足不同的应用场景的需要。SQL下的Oracle序列可以有效地减少数据库所需的存储空间,提高效率,并实现数据可靠性。本文将介绍Oracle序列实现时应该按照什么步骤进行。

第一步:创建序列。使用SQL语句”CREATE SEQUENCE Seq_Name”可以创建Oracle序列。可以设置开始和结束数值,也可以规定步长,以及如何处理其他操作等等。

第二步:使用序列。在使用Oracle序列时,可以使用“NEXTVAL”或者“CURRVAL”函数来获取序列变量的值。如果要使用当前值,需要先使用“NEXTVAL”函数获取一个值,然后再使用“CURRVAL”函数获取当前值。

第三步:编写程序来保存序列变量。Oracle序列是由程序维护的,创建的序列变量会在重新启动进程时被重置,因此如果要在不同的连接之间保持序列值不变,就需要编写程序来保存序列变量。

第四步:对序列变量进行管理。Oracle序列变量可以被编辑或者调整,也可以从数据库中删除。如果要管理序列变量,可以使用“ALTER SEQUENCE Seq_Name”语句来实现。

第五步:其他应用场景。在某些场景下,可以使用Oracle序列将序列变量转换为表达式,以此来动态更新序列值,也可以使用它实现主备复制。

一步一步探索Oracle序列,可以帮助我们实现更加可靠、有效的数据管理。它可以减少存储空间,提高工作效率,也是一款非常专业的应用开发工具。


数据运维技术 » 的实现Oracle序列的实现:一步一步探索(oracle当前序列)